Interface Descriptions

1. Power Supply: 2PIN 3.5mm pitch terminal block.

PIN | Power | DI/DO | Description

1 | V+ | | Power input Positive, 9-36VDC

2 | V- | | Power input Negative

3 | | DI | Digital input (Maximum absolute voltage: 30V. Maximum absolute current: 20mA)

4 | | GND | Ground

5 | | DO | Digital output (Maximum absolute voltage: 30V. Maximum absolute current: 20mA)

DI&DO Internal Diagram: A diagram shows the internal connections for Digital Input and Output with components like a 4.7K resistor and a sensor connected to VDD=12V and GND.

2. LED Indicator.

Name | Color | Status | Description

RUN | Green | On, solid | Router is powered on (System is initializing)

RUN | Green | On, blinking | Router starts operating

RUN | Green | Off | Router is powered off

MDM | Green | On, solid | Link connection is working

MDM | Green | On, blinking | Data is sent and received.

MDM | Green | Off | Link connection is not working

USR (OpenVPN) | Green | On, solid | OpenVPN connection is established

USR (OpenVPN) | Green | Off | OpenVPN connection is not established

USR (IPsec) | Green | On, solid | IPsec connection is established

USR (IPsec) | Green | Off | IPsec connection is not established

RSSI | Green | On, solid | Signal Level: Best Signal Level (Wireless module: 21-31dB)

RSSI | Green | On, slow blinking (1s) | Signal Level: Average Signal Level (Wireless module: 11-20dB)

RSSI | Green | On, fast blinking | Signal Level: Abnormal Signal Level (Wireless module: 21-31dB)

RSSI | Green | Off | No signal

WLAN | Green | On, solid | WLAN is enabled and working properly

WLAN | Green | Off | WLAN is disabled or not working properly

Note: The display type of the USR LED can be configured. Refer to RT123_SM_RobustOS Software Manual, Services > Advanced > System > System Settings > User LED Type for details.

3. Reset Button.

Function | Operation

Reboot | Press and hold the RST button for 2~5 seconds under the operating status.

Restore to default configuration | Press and hold the RST button for 5~10 seconds. The RUN LED will blink quickly, and the router will restore to default configuration.

Restore to factory default settings | Performing the restore to default configuration operation twice within one minute will restore the router to factory default settings.

Note: For more details, refer to RT123_SM_RobustOS Software Manual, Section 2.3 Factory Reset.

4. Ethernet Ports.

The R1510 has two Ethernet ports: ETH0 (WAN/LAN) and ETH1. Each port has two LED indicators: a green link indicator and a yellow indicator (which has no specific meaning). See the table below for status details.

Ethernet LED Indicator | Status | Description

Link indicator (Green) | On, solid | Connection is established

Link indicator (Green) | On, blinking | Data is being transferred

Link indicator (Green) | Off | Connection is not established

6. Power Supply Installation.

Two cables are associated with the power adapter. Connect the red cable to the positive pole and the yellow cable to the negative pole of the terminal block.

Note: The power voltage range is 9 to 36V DC.

CONNECTING THE POWER CABLE

COLOR | POLARITY

RED | +

YELLOW | -

Diagram shows the power adapter cables (red and yellow) connected to a terminal block labeled V+ and V-.

Login to the Device

1. Connect the router's Ethernet port to a PC using a standard Ethernet cable.

2. Before logging in, manually configure the PC with a static IP address on the same subnet as the gateway address. Select "Use the following IP address".

A screenshot of the Internet Protocol Version 4 (TCP/IPv4) Properties window is shown, with options to obtain an IP address automatically or use a specific IP address. Example settings are provided: IP address: 192.168.0.2, Subnet mask: 255.255.255.0, Default gateway: 192.168.0.1. DNS server settings are also shown.

3. Enter the gateway's web interface by typing http://192.168.0.1 into the URL field of your Internet browser.

4. Use the login information shown on the product label when prompted for authentication.

An image shows the Robustel login screen with fields for username and password, and a LOGIN button.

5. After logging in, the home page of the web interface is displayed. You can view system information and perform configuration on the device.

A screenshot of the Robustel web interface is shown, displaying System Information such as Device Model, Firmware Version, Hardware Version, Serial Number, and system status.

6. The automatic APN selection is ON by default. To specify your own APN, navigate to Interface > Link Manager > Link Setting > WWAN Settings.

A screenshot of the WWAN Settings page is shown, with options for Automatic APN Selection, APN, Username, Password, and Dialup Number.

7. For more detailed configuration information, please refer to the RT123_SM_RobustOS Software Manual.

Radio Specifications

RF technologies: 2G, 3G, 4G, Wi-Fi

Cellular Frequency: 2G: GSM: B3/B8; 3G: WCDMA: B1/B8; 4G: LTE FDD: B1/B3/B7/B8/B20/B28A

Max RF power: 33 dBm±2dB@2G, 24 dBm+1/-3dB@WCDMA, 23 dBm±2 dBm@LTE.

* May vary on different models.
